Disability Ramp Repair in Overland Park, KS
Disability ramp repair services focus on restoring safety, stability, and accessibility to existing ramps on residential properties. These projects typically involve fixing damaged or worn-out components, such as replacing broken handrails, repairing uneven surfaces, or reinforcing structural elements to meet accessibility standards. Property owners often request these repairs to ensure that ramps remain safe for regular use, accommodate mobility needs, and comply with relevant accessibility guidelines.
Before requesting ramp repair services, homeowners and property owners usually want to understand the scope of work needed, including the extent of damage and any modifications required to improve safety. It’s also helpful to consider the materials used in the existing ramp, the overall condition of the structure, and whether repairs will address current issues or if upgrades are necessary. Clear communication about these aspects can assist in planning effective repairs that enhance accessibility and safety for all users.

Disability Ramp Repair Questions
What types of damage require ramp repair? Damage from weather, wear and tear, or accidents can affect ramps, making repairs necessary for safety and accessibility.
How can I tell if my ramp needs repair? Signs include loose handrails, unstable surfaces, cracks, or difficulty in opening or closing the ramp.
What materials are commonly used for ramp repairs? Repairs often involve replacing or reinforcing wood, metal, or composite materials to restore durability and safety.
Are repairs needed for both residential and commercial ramps? Yes, both types of ramps can require repairs to maintain compliance and safe access.
